The cheapest way to get from Uckfield Station to Hever Castle is to drive which costs £4 - £7 and takes 30 min.
The fastest way to get from Uckfield Station to Hever Castle is to taxi which takes 30 min and costs £35 - £50.
Yes, there is a direct train departing from Uckfield and arriving at Hever. Services depart hourly,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 31 min.
The distance between Uckfield Station and Hever Castle is 20 miles. The road distance is 17.4 miles.
The best way to get from Uckfield Station to Hever Castle without a car is to train which takes 55 min and costs £9 - £19.
The train from Uckfield to Hever takes 31 min including transfers and departs hourly.
Uckfield Station to Hever Castle train services, operated by Southern, depart from Uckfield station.
Uckfield Station to Hever Castle train services, operated by Southern, arrive at Hever station.
Yes, the driving distance between Uckfield Station to Hever Castle is 17 miles. It takes approximately 30 min to drive from Uckfield Station to Hever Castle.
